Take the air cleaner element [A].
Checking:
Check whether the filter element is polluted or
damaged.
Please replace with a new one if it has been polluted or
damaged.
Cleaning:
Rinse the filter element softly and thoroughly with
cleaner.
Then apply the oil to the filter element and then
squeeze out the redundant oil, so that the filter element
is moist without oil dripping.
Remark
Do not use the gasoline so as not to cause fires.
○Do not distort or warp the filter element so as not
to damage the foam materials.
Install a new filter element [5].
Note
The recommended air filter element (Benelli
part number: 49202N220002) must be used. If
other air filter elements are used, the engine will
be worn prematurely or the performance of
engine will be reduced.
●Carry out the installation and disassembly in a reverse
process.
●Tighten air filter air inlet screw
●Reinstall the removed parts.

Benelli TNT125 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Displacement125 cc
Transmission5-speed
Fuel SystemEFI
Fuel Capacity7.2 liters
Seat Height780 mm
Dry Weight116 kg
Bore x Stroke54 mm x 54.5 mm
Starting SystemElectric
Wheelbase1215 mm
Engine TypeSingle cylinder, 4-stroke, air-cooled
Front SuspensionUpside-down fork
Front BrakeSingle disc
Rear BrakeSingle disc
Front Tire120/70-12
Rear Tire130/70-12
Max Power8.2 kW (11.1 Cv) @ 9500 rpm
Rear SuspensionSwing arm with lateral shock absorber with adjustable spring preload
